Agricultural implement
The present invention relates to an agricultural implement comprising a main frame supporting a plurality of ground engaging tools, the main frame being transferable between a first configuration, in which a first plurality of ground engaging tools are in a working position, and a second configuration, in which a second plurality of ground engaging tools are in a working position. A first depth wheel is connected to the main frame and capable of adjusting a working depth of the first plurality of ground engaging tools, when the main frame is in its first configuration. A second depth wheel connected to the main frame and capable of adjusting a working depth of the second plurality of ground engaging tools, when the main frame is in its second configuration. At least the first depth wheel is pivotable in such a way that the first depth wheel moves with respect to the second depth wheel.
Replaceable shank wear shin
A shank assembly for an agricultural tillage implement including a shank, a point removably connected to the shank, and a protective guard removably connected in between the point and the shank. The point retains the protective guard on the shank. The protective guard is configured for protecting the shank and flexing in response to a movement of the shank.

Semi-mounted plough
A semi-mounted plough has a rear chassis, the plough trailing behind a plough-towing tractor in a laterally pivotable or steerable manner by a vertically oriented joint. In order to compensate lateral pulling for the tractor, which is generated by the traction force of the plough about the vertical axis of the tractor, an energy accumulator is arranged, which generates a torque counteracting the lateral pulling.
Pivoting support wheel for mounting on a plow frame
A rotary plow (1) with pivoting support wheel (2) for mounting on a plow frame (3). The pivoting support wheel (2) is suitable for plows projecting far behind, such as multi-plowbody mounted, reversible plows or semi-mounted reversible plows with a movable rear part. Furthermore, the pivoting support wheel (2) exhibits self-steering characteristics which have different support or steering forces which act on the pivoting support wheel (2) or the plow frame (3) through the pushed or forwardly-directed arrangement of the pivot arm, and thus enables an accurate lateral guidance of the plow.

Pivoting support wheel for a reversible plough
A swivelling support wheel for a reversible plough is proposed that is adjusted with a toothed segment and a catch and gives the working depth of the ploughing tools.
